How to Play Monte Carlo Jewels HD Slot for Real Money Online
1. RTP (Return to Player): 96.2%
The RTP of Monte Carlo Jewels HD stands at 96.2%. This indicates that, on average, players can expect to reclaim 96.2 coins for every 100 coins wagered. This is a competitive RTP, suggesting that the slot provides a reasonable return compared to many others in the market. The remaining 3.8 coins constitute the casino's edge.
